LINUX.ORG.RU

h.264 или Theora? Битва за HTML5 начинается!

 , , , ,


0

0

Интернет-сообщество замерло в ожидании прихода HTML5, а особенно реализации тега «video», который поможет раз и навсегда избавиться от Flash компании Adobe. Но до сих пор остается не решенной проблема выбора стандарта кодека для распространения видео в Web.

На сегодня есть два основных конкурента - проприетарный кодек h.264 и свободный Theora. В пользу h.264 говорит более широкая аппаратная-поддержка этого алгоритма и широко разрекламированное превосходящее качество изображения. Theora же поддерживается «из коробки» многими браузерами: Chrome, Firefox, Opera, и не имеет никаких лицензионных ограничений.

Но, возможно, победа достанется Theora, поскольку она не накладывает лицензионных ограничений на конечного пользователя. К тому же, MPEG-LA недавно опубликовала разъяснение, по которому существует определенный барьер, после чего производитель обязан платить за использование h.264.

Ален Харкнес, Директор по лицензированию MPEG-LA, поясняет, что отчисления за лицензию могут быть уплачены на любой стадии производства и распространения продукта, но если отчисления не были уплачены, продукт является не лицензированным и его распространители/конечные пользователи могут быть привлечены к ответственности.

>>> Подробности



Проверено: anonymous_incognito ()
Последнее исправление: anonymous_incognito (всего исправлений: 1)

Ответ на: комментарий от tot-to

>Только вот есть ли сейчас рабочий аддон для FF, который бы подменял собой область тега <video> и при клике на неё запускал внешний плеер?

К сожалению есть и может ронять браузер.

madcore ★★★★★
()
Ответ на: комментарий от Alan_Steel

>Разработчик из страны, где нет софт-патентов написал вот такую фичу.

Разработчик из свободной страны продаёт ядерную бомбу. Вы можете заказать её, пройдя по ссылке.


:) Фича быть может, а вот законно ли на неё ссылаться, это ещё вопрос.

Deleted
()
Ответ на: комментарий от Deleted

>флеш станет не необходимоей фичей на большинстве десктопов

А как же онлайн-игры для хомячков, наподобие вконтактовских, или мейлрушных?

vspider ★★
()
Ответ на: комментарий от vspider

> А как же онлайн-игры для хомячков, наподобие вконтактовских, или мейлрушных?

Тут уже предлагали все на svg+js переписать.

Werehuman ★★
()
Ответ на: комментарий от linux4ever

> Какой тупой двачер попался, сайты на которые давали ссылки легко работают без флеша.

Ты главное не нервничай, и так понятно что у тебя всё работает и без браузера.

anonymous
()
Ответ на: комментарий от vspider

>А как же онлайн-игры для хомячков, наподобие вконтактовских, или мейлрушных?

Вот для них и останется, как всё тот же шоквейв. Можно найти дохрена сайтов с шоквейв играми, но сайтов, свёрстанных с использованием шоквейва для других целей почти не осталось.

Gary ★★★★★
()
Ответ на: комментарий от vspider

Последние версии HTML5 позволяют не использовать флеш вообще нигде. Главная проблема в том, что броузерописцы опять не могут договориться. Честное слово, задолбали. Буду ржать, если IE опять захватит рынок.

linux4ever
()
Ответ на: комментарий от Alan_Steel

> Ядерная бомба попросту не пройдёт растаможку ;)

Ядерный реактор пройдет, причем с 0% пошлиной. Можно сделать some kind of грязная бомба.

anonymous
()

УРА!!! Товарищи

так долго ждал, и вот.. я счастлив.. пусть хоть полуубогая Theora буде.. а не убогий флеш. аж слеза навернулась.

кстати, пресловутый youtube на html5 уже шпилит, правда бетка, но когда увидел - доставило)

psionik
()
Ответ на: комментарий от linux4ever

Скажем спасибо нокии и эппл за это, они, помнится, были против теоры.

Deleted
()
Ответ на: комментарий от anonymous

Я что-то нигде не видел запрета отдельным гражданам обладать энергоустановками. ;)

А бомбу можно сделать и подручными средствами, которые покупаются в любой аптеке.

Alan_Steel ★★
()
Ответ на: комментарий от linux4ever

customVid Как раз не работает для тега video, а именно для встроенного флеша. И работает как-то странно: на ТыТрубе появилась сверху кнопка Stream, которая вообще нифига не делает, а снизу - ссылка download, дающая прямую ссылку на видео. Сам FF пытается при клике показать содержимое, которое оказывается пустым, поэтому всё равно приходится проделывать шаманское действие: правой крысой по ссылке - copy link location - shift-ins в какое-нить гуишное окно с полем ввода - выделить крысой ссылку - написать в терминале mplayer - средней крысой по терминалу - enter.

Меня такая бессмысленная последовательность действий несколько напрягает.

tot-to
()
Ответ на: комментарий от Deleted

> Сделают на SVG и JS. Не сразу, да. А ты как хотел. Простые штуки уже даже есть, хотя их пока мало.

Постые штуки на svg+js есть уже лет 10 как. И дальше них - не выходит каменный цветок. И понятно почему - потому что браузеры толком не поддерживают svg, потому что нет нормальных инструментов разработки, потому что создатели никак не могут между собой договорится... В результате имеем то что имеем - адоба помаялась лет несколько с svg, подвигала и... купила макромедию с ее флешом. После этого какое-либо шевеление в стане svg увы полность прекратилось.

anonymous
()
Ответ на: комментарий от anonymous

> (ii) DECODE AVC, VC-1, MPEG-4 PART 2 AND MPEG-2 VIDEO THAT WAS ENCODED BY A CONSUMER ENGAGED IN A PERSONAL AND NON-COMMERICAL ACTIVITY AND/OR WAS OBTAINED FROM A VIDEO PROVIDER LICENSED TO PROVIDE SUCH VIDEO.

Теперь расскажи мне, как определить - коммерческое видео или нет, каким образом понять лицензирован провайдер, или же нет. И в каких случаях потребитель вообще может декодировать полученное видео (сделанное не им самим)

Alan_Steel ★★
()
Ответ на: комментарий от Deleted

а кто этим будет заниматься?

Может, подскажешь, где есть примеры работ? Просто на этом уже крутится огромный бизнес, те же платные игры-сервисы... Я, кстати, в качестве альтернативы вижу также java-апплеты - вполне вероятно, но опять же, кто будет переделывать...

Можно попробовать как-нить самому на досуге раздраконить простенькую флеш-игру и собрать всё это на js...

vspider ★★
()
Ответ на: комментарий от anonymous

>Постые штуки на svg+js есть уже лет 10 как.

10 лет назад в браузерах было такое SVG, да… Пилить SVG в браузерах начали относительно недавно, потому и мало. А svg плагин адобы был, кстати, кривой с точки зрения SVG стандарта.

Deleted
()
Ответ на: а кто этим будет заниматься? от vspider

А новые игры не будут что ли уже разрабатываться, только старые?

Подтянут поддержку SVG в браузерах, в плане скорости и поддержки, потихоньку будут все условия. Вполне реально. Но, как уже и было сказано, это не сразу происходит.

Deleted
()
Ответ на: комментарий от linux4ever

>Последние версии HTML5 позволяют не использовать флеш вообще нигде. Главная проблема в том, что броузерописцы опять не могут договориться. Честное слово, задолбали. Буду ржать, если IE опять захватит рынок.

А это пофиг, главное чтобы их реализация 100% соответствовала стандарту и не выходила по возможностям за стандарт (а то дебилы опять начнут юзать ms-only расширения и появиться зоопарк в html5).

EvgenijM86
()

а пусть Оракл купит еще и MPEG-LA ..

anonymous
()
Ответ на: а кто этим будет заниматься? от vspider

>Просто на этом уже крутится огромный бизнес, те же платные игры-сервисы...

Internets, serious business, yeah

Я конечно не копенгаген, но по-моему огромный бизнес это когда миллионы людей платят по десять баксов в месяц за клиентские мморпг. Как получить прибыль с пасьянсов для Бабы Глаши — не представляю.

Gary ★★★★★
()
Ответ на: комментарий от darkshvein

>Мм. Съеора Съеора. Что насчёт коэффициента сжатия то? А несколько ядер оно держит? И ещё. конечное качество выводимого изображения может отличаться. Я, конечно, проголосую за открытый формат, но как бы не было потом абыдна.

Никто не запрещает размещать видео в h.264 опционально.

anonymous
()
Ответ на: комментарий от anonymous

>Никто не запрещает размещать видео в h.264 опционально

Подозреваю, youtube от опциального размещения теоры профита не будет, а будет только удвоено занятое место.

Gary ★★★★★
()

Будет Theora не иначе!!!

anonymous
()
Ответ на: комментарий от raystlin

>Допилят же если что.

Главное, что б не как «линукс на десктопе»

Keplian
()

Удивительно что в этом треде встречаются люди, которые думают, что флеш в дизайне сайта ещё не умер. Единственное, для чего современные сайты (а не корпоративное уныние времён николая второго) используют флеш - для видео.

Ну иногда надо какую-то хитрую функциональность сделать вроде вебсокетов, но это редкость.

И да, массовое увлечение js движками, байт-компиляцией и прочим есть показатель того, за чем будущее в веб-интерфейсах.

anonymous
()
Ответ на: комментарий от Gary

>Ни один крупный сайт не позволит себе вместо удобно свёрстанной html-страницы сделать какое-то поделие, которое будет сомнительно выглядеть, тормозить, но зато свистеть, пердеть и крутиться.

Как у подавляющего большинства музыкантов.

raystlin
()

Всего лишь вопрос: обычно флэш юзают для видео. Но ведь иногда на нем делают и некие интерактивные сайты и веб-программы. Неужели тег видео настолько крут что заменяет абобе флэсш на все 100%?

I-Love-Microsoft ★★★★★
()
Ответ на: комментарий от anonymous

>Удивительно что в этом треде встречаются люди, которые думают, что флеш в дизайне сайта ещё не умер. Единственное, для чего современные сайты (а не корпоративное уныние времён николая второго) используют флеш - для видео.

Как узко. Корпораций мало и миллионы средних и мелких компаний. Популярность дали флешу не корпорации как вы считаете.

Флеш для:

1. Игровая идустрия. Теснит только Java.
2. Реклама. GIF был убит флешом в этом направлении. Аналогов живых нет (SVG не всчет).
3. Интерактивные меню, диалоги и т.п. Конкурент - AJAX с HTML5
4. Медиаплееры. Конкурент - HTML5.
5. <Впишите своё>

gh0stwizard ★★★★★
()

как то печально все. Не люблю такой случай - либо хорошее, либо открытое.

mikhalich ★★
()
Ответ на: комментарий от I-Love-Microsoft

Не «тэг видео», а HTML5 в целом. Читайте тред.

slovazap ★★★★★
()
Ответ на: комментарий от slovazap

>Потому что иначе целая страна будет в отстое по сравнению с какой-то там рашкой.

а ничего что в России тоже есть патенты на H.264?

thevery ★★★★
()
Ответ на: комментарий от raystlin

Я, конечно, проголосую за открытый формат, но как бы не было потом абыдна.

Допилят же если что.

Кодек это ж не ядро.Тут уже зона простых быдлопользователей. Его надо переустанавливать тогда, перерегистрировать в соот. органах, да и огнелис и проч программы работающие с ним, вероятно, придётся переписывать.

darkshvein ☆☆
()
Ответ на: комментарий от slovazap

А что, может быть уже есть тесты где теора не сливает всухую?


На низких битрейтах теора очень крута, выбирал кодек для онлайн трансляции видео с концертов - выбрал её.

anonizmus
()
Ответ на: комментарий от gh0stwizard

> 1. Игровая идустрия. Теснит только Java.

2. Реклама. GIF был убит флешом в этом направлении. Аналогов живых нет (SVG не всчет).
3. Интерактивные меню, диалоги и т.п. Конкурент - AJAX с HTML5
4. Медиаплееры. Конкурент - HTML5.

Во-во, 1 сразу блочим, а 3 и 4 флеш заменен HTML5. Итого остались только убогие игрульки - в общем у флеша осталась только одна ниша - компы скучающих секрутуток. Я считаю, это равноценно полному и безоговорочному флешокапцу.

slovazap ★★★★★
()
Ответ на: комментарий от thevery

> а ничего что в России тоже есть патенты на H.264?

Ничего. Бабки - маразматички из роспатента сами не читают того, на что шлепают печати - у них можно запатентовать хоть Путина. По закону никаких патентов нет, да и у кастратского с аббрвалгг'ом тоже - любой юрист вам это подтвердит.

slovazap ★★★★★
()
Ответ на: комментарий от anonizmus

> На низких битрейтах теора очень крута, выбирал кодек для онлайн трансляции видео с концертов - выбрал её.

Подробные результаты сравнения в студию. До тех пор никого не волнует что вы там кривыми руками сравнивали и слепыми глазами выбирали.

slovazap ★★★★★
()
Ответ на: комментарий от slovazap

>Итого остались только убогие игрульки

Вы как-то странно мыслите. Это гугл со своей plain-text рекламой выживает. Остальные только через флеш. Ах да, забыл про сильвер-лайт =)

Игрушек на яве нормальных я не видел. Последняя была FreeCol, которая работает так, как будто у меня пень первый, это не есть гуд. Ява хороша для апплетов под управление девайсами, аля web-робототехника =)

gh0stwizard ★★★★★
()
Ответ на: комментарий от slovazap

Подробные результаты сравнения в студию. До тех пор никого не волнует что вы там кривыми руками сравнивали


%-) Пионэры такие пионэры. Делать мне нехер тока ламерам с лора какие то сравнения давать. Слыш, ты, я задачи решаю а не с школьниками спорю. Попробуй для начала на unix платформе нормальное реалтайм онлайн вещание видео наладить, можешь начать с чтения мануала для icecast2 %-)

зы, отпишись сюда, пионэр, с тестами %)

anonizmus
()
Ответ на: комментарий от I-Love-Microsoft

>Всего лишь вопрос: обычно флэш юзают для видео. Но ведь иногда на нем делают и некие интерактивные сайты и веб-программы. Неужели тег видео настолько крут что заменяет абобе флэсш на все 100%?

Отдельный тег видео не настолько крут, но крут сам HTML5.

EvgenijM86
()
Ответ на: комментарий от darkshvein

Это гуд ^_^


вообще теора и ресурсов жрет не так много, для реалтайм сжатия, если камеры нет попробуй пакет gtk-recordMyDesktop поюзать, там галочку поставь «сжимать на лету» оно как раз в теору жмет. У меня юзало оба ядра. А вот ffmpeg2theora в последний раз когда я пробовал (года два назад) напрямую распаралеливаться не хотело еще (пережимал входной поток mpeg2, который забирал с карты видеозахвата в реалтайме для заливки через oggfwd на icecast2)

anonizmus
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.